Important Lycian cities of antiquity

Patara Ancient City Patara Ancient City It is a city that has inspired today's US government, became the center of civilization and trade in the ancient age, and has been preserved until today thanks to the sea sands that cover it. Especially the rest of the parliament building and port structures, which have been restored, are worth seeing!

It was invaded twice in their history (Persian and Roman), but it is one of the most developed cities of its time, where a proud people preferred mass suicide rather than being captured in their last moments of defending their city.

Xanthos Antik Kenti - Ancient ruins of Xanthos
